Output 72c54d96e4f649817ca8a341857d6d94bdb07b4601a8e03a5518364390d6b981:32

value
503853
script pubkey
OP_0 OP_PUSHBYTES_20 35cc39bd12b224ede89064e1e115b919c9431afd
address
bc1qxhxrn0gjkgjwm6ysvns7z9der8y5xxha6hwldu
transaction
72c54d96e4f649817ca8a341857d6d94bdb07b4601a8e03a5518364390d6b981
spent
true